本說明書中公開的涉及對打印機(jī)的控制進(jìn)行支持的支持程序。
背景技術(shù):
1、作為從個人計(jì)算機(jī)等信息處理裝置控制打印機(jī)的技術(shù),以下的結(jié)構(gòu)廣為人知:在信息處理裝置安裝打印機(jī)驅(qū)動程序,利用打印機(jī)驅(qū)動程序來生成打印數(shù)據(jù),將該打印數(shù)據(jù)向打印機(jī)發(fā)送(例如,專利文獻(xiàn)1)。打印機(jī)驅(qū)動程序從打印機(jī)的制造商提供,支持該打印機(jī)所具有的各種功能,能夠充分利用該打印機(jī)。
2、現(xiàn)有技術(shù)文獻(xiàn)
3、專利文獻(xiàn)
4、專利文獻(xiàn)1:日本特開2017-134718號公報(bào)
技術(shù)實(shí)現(xiàn)思路
1、發(fā)明所要解決的課題
2、近年來,不利用前述的打印機(jī)驅(qū)動程序而通過裝入于操作系統(tǒng)(os)標(biāo)準(zhǔn)的通用打印程序來控制打印機(jī)的技術(shù)被實(shí)用化。在該技術(shù)中,os若檢知到打印機(jī)則進(jìn)行與os標(biāo)準(zhǔn)的通用打印程序的關(guān)聯(lián)建立,以后,在接受了對于該打印機(jī)的打印指示的情況下,能夠不使用打印機(jī)驅(qū)動程序地進(jìn)行基于os標(biāo)準(zhǔn)的通用打印程序的打印。
3、然而,在使用os標(biāo)準(zhǔn)的通用打印程序的信息處理裝置中,在打印指示之前顯示與打印機(jī)的狀態(tài)相關(guān)的信息的結(jié)構(gòu)是未知的。因而,即使在打印機(jī)產(chǎn)生了卡紙等錯誤,用戶有時也會不知道該情況而指示打印執(zhí)行,因此存在改善的余地。
4、用于解決課題的手段
5、以上述的課題的解決為目的而完成的支持程序能夠由信息處理裝置的計(jì)算機(jī)執(zhí)行,對應(yīng)于與所述信息處理裝置連接的打印機(jī),對預(yù)先裝入到所述信息處理裝置的操作系統(tǒng)的通用打印程序進(jìn)行支持,其中,所述通用打印程序能夠處理用于使打印設(shè)定畫面顯示于所述信息處理裝置的顯示器的數(shù)據(jù),所述支持程序構(gòu)成為:在因選擇了所述打印機(jī)而從所述通用打印程序要求了處理的情況下,使所述計(jì)算機(jī)執(zhí)行取得處理、生成處理及顯示處理,所述取得處理是取得表示所述打印機(jī)的狀態(tài)的狀態(tài)信息的處理,所述生成處理是基于在所述取得處理中取得的所述狀態(tài)信息而生成表示向用戶通知的通知內(nèi)容的通知數(shù)據(jù)的處理,所述顯示處理是將在所述生成處理中生成的所述通知數(shù)據(jù)向所述通用打印程序遞交且使所述通知數(shù)據(jù)顯示于在所述信息處理裝置的所述顯示器顯示的所述打印設(shè)定畫面的處理。
6、本說明書中公開的支持程序,在選擇了對應(yīng)的打印機(jī)時,取得打印機(jī)的狀態(tài)信息,生成基于該狀態(tài)信息的通知數(shù)據(jù)并向通用打印程序遞交,利用通用打印程序使通知數(shù)據(jù)顯示于打印設(shè)定畫面。由此,在使用os標(biāo)準(zhǔn)的通用打印程序的信息處理裝置中,能夠在打印指示之前使與打印機(jī)的狀態(tài)相關(guān)的信息顯示,作為其結(jié)果,用戶能夠在輸入打印指示前知道與該打印機(jī)的狀態(tài)相關(guān)的信息。
7、裝入有上述支持程序的信息處理裝置、保存支持程序的可由計(jì)算機(jī)讀取的存儲介質(zhì)及用于實(shí)現(xiàn)支持程序的功能的控制方法、包含支持程序和打印機(jī)的打印系統(tǒng)也是新穎且有用的。
8、發(fā)明效果
9、根據(jù)本說明書中公開的技術(shù),實(shí)現(xiàn)在裝入有os標(biāo)準(zhǔn)的通用打印程序的信息處理裝置中在打印指示之前顯示與打印機(jī)的狀態(tài)相關(guān)的信息的技術(shù)。
1.一種支持程序,能夠由信息處理裝置的計(jì)算機(jī)執(zhí)行,對應(yīng)于與所述信息處理裝置連接的打印機(jī),對預(yù)先裝入到所述信息處理裝置的操作系統(tǒng)的通用打印程序進(jìn)行支持,其中,
2.根據(jù)權(quán)利要求1所述的支持程序,
3.根據(jù)權(quán)利要求1所述的支持程序,
4.根據(jù)權(quán)利要求1~3中任一項(xiàng)所述的支持程序,
5.根據(jù)權(quán)利要求1~4中任一項(xiàng)所述的支持程序,
6.根據(jù)權(quán)利要求1~5中任一項(xiàng)所述的支持程序,
7.根據(jù)權(quán)利要求1~6中任一項(xiàng)所述的支持程序,